The World's First CCTV Engineering Platform

Securify is the world's first CCTV engineering platform powered by the Haydes Spatial Intelligence Engine. Built for security consultants, system integrators, and regulatory authorities worldwide, it combines spatial intelligence, DORI analysis, authority compliance, storage calculations, and engineering documentation into a single workflow. Currently optimized for SIRA (Dubai) and MCC (Abu Dhabi), with additional regulatory frameworks in development.

Our platform supports SIRA compliance (Security Industry Regulatory Agency) for Dubai and MCC compliance (Monitoring and Control Centre) for Abu Dhabi — with more Gulf regulatory frameworks coming soon including Saudi Arabia, Qatar, Bahrain, Kuwait, and Oman.

Traditional CCTV design involves manual calculations, inconsistent drawings, and uncertainty around regulatory requirements. Securify eliminates this by providing structured, rule-based design tools that automatically align your surveillance system design with local authority requirements.
